Vianmääritys
Tutustu seuraaviin yleisiin ongelmiin, joita saatat kohdata teemaeditorin käytössä, sekä niiden ratkaisuihin. Jos sinulla on ongelmia teemaeditorin käytössä, tarkista, onko ongelma kuvattu alla.
Tällä sivulla
Sivu uudelleenohjaa URL-osoitteeseen, jota ei tueta
Jos myyntipaikassasi on koodia, joka ohjaa käyttäjät URL-osoitteisiin, joita ei ole liitetty kauppaasi, tarkista, että uudelleenohjaus on poistettu käytöstä, kun vierailet teemaeditorissa.
Tällainen uudelleenohjaus voidaan esimerkiksi lisätä myyntipaikkaan asiakkaiden ohjaamiseksi eri Shopify-kauppoihin sijainnin mukaan. Tällainen uudelleenohjauskoodi voi olla joko teemassa tai asentamassasi sovelluksessa.
Varmista, ettei uudelleenohjaus häiritse editorin käyttöä, käyttämällä JavaScriptissä viittausta window.Shopify.designMode
-muuttujaan, joka poistaa uudelleenohjauksen käytöstä, kun käytät teemaeditoria. Tämä muuttuja asetetaan arvoon true
, kun myyntipaikka on ladattu editoriin, ja arvoon false
, kun sitä ei ole ladattu.
Sivu ei latautunut virheen vuoksi
Sivun latautuminen teemaeditorissa voi epäonnistua useista syistä. Yleisiä ongelmia ovat mm. seuraavat:
- verkkoyhteysongelmat
- teemassasi oleva virheellinen Liquid-koodi.
Jos olet tarkistanut, että kyseiset ongelmat eivät aiheuta virhettä, kokeile mennä verkkokauppaasi siirtymällä teemaeditorissa kohtaan Teeman toiminnot > Esikatsele teemaa. Jos sivun lataaminen ei onnistu, voit ottaa yhteyttä Shopify-tukeen saadaksesi apua myyntipaikkaasi koskevan ongelman ratkaisemiseen.
HTML-virhe löytyi
Jos teeman koodissa on syntaksivirhe, teemaeditorissa näkyy HTML-virhe löytyi -varoitusviesti.
Voit ratkaista virheen tarkastelemalla virheilmoituksessa mainitun Liquid-tiedoston koodia.
Ongelman löytäminen teeman koodista
- Klikkaa virheilmoitukseen linkitettyä
.liquid
-osiotiedostoa. Linkki vie sinut Muokkaa HTML-/CSS-koodia ‑sivulle, missä tiedosto aukeaa koodieditorissa. -
Käy läpi tiedostossa oleva koodi ja yritä löytää virheellinen HTML- tai Liquid-osa. Koodieditorissa mahdolliset syntaksivirheet näkyvät punaisena. Yleisiä ongelmia ovat mm. seuraavat:
- ylimääräiset HTML-lopputunnisteet, esimerkiksi lopputunniste
</div>
ilman alkutunnistetta<div>
- ylimääräiset HTML-alkutunnisteet, kuten alkutunniste
<div>
ilman lopputunnistetta</div>
- väärin muotoillut HTML-tunnisteet, esimerkiksi
<div class="my-class"
ilman>
- väärin muotoiltu Liquid-koodi
- viallinen HTML sisällytetyssä teeman koodinpätkätiedostossa.
- ylimääräiset HTML-lopputunnisteet, esimerkiksi lopputunniste
Kun olet löytänyt ongelman, korjaa koodi teematiedostossasi.
Klikkaa Tallenna.
Palaa teemaeditoriin valitsemalla Mukauta ja varmista, että virhesanomaa ei enää näytetä.
Muita ratkaisuja
Jos sinulla on edelleen ongelmia teeman kanssa käytyäsi läpi yleiset vianmääritysvaiheet, mieti, olisiko seuraavista toimenpiteistä apua:
- Palauta teematiedostosi vanha versio.
- Asenna teeman uusin versio Theme Storesta ja ota se käyttöön.
- Katso, millaista tukea teemallesi on saatavilla.